In order to be effective, a seat belt must:
– be tightened as close to the body as
possible.
– be pulled in front of you with a smooth
movement, checking that it is not twisted.
– must only be used to secure one person.
– not show signs of tearing or fraying.
– not be changed or modified, in order to
avoid affecting its performance.
Recommendations for children
Use a suitable child seat if the passenger
is less than 12 years old or shorter than 1.5
metres.
Never use the same seat belt to secure more
than one child.
Never carry a child on your lap.
For more information on Child seats, refer to
the corresponding section.
Maintenance
In accordance with current safety
regulations, for all work on your vehicle's
seat belts, contact a qualified workshop with
the skills and equipment needed, which a
PEUGEOT dealer is able to provide.
62
Have the seat belts checked regularly by a
PEUGEOT dealer or a qualified workshop,
particularly if the straps show signs of
damage.
Clean the seat belt straps with soapy water or
a textile cleaning product, sold by PEUGEOT
dealers.
Airbags
The airbags have been designed to optimise the
safety of the occupants in the event of a serious
collision; they work in conjunction with the force
limiting seat belts.
In the event of a serious collision, electronic
detectors record and analyse any abrupt
deceleration of the vehicle:
– if there is a violent impact, the airbags deploy
instantly and help better protect occupants of the
vehicle; immediately after the impact, the airbags
deflate rapidly in order not to hinder the visibility
or the possible exit of the occupants.
– in the case of a minor or rear impact or in
certain rollover conditions, the airbags are not
deployed; the seat belt alone contributes towards
ensuring your protection in these situations.
The airbags do not operate when the
engine is not running.
This equipment will only deploy once. If a
second impact occurs (during the same or a
subsequent accident), the airbag will not be
deployed again.
Deployment of the airbags is
accompanied by a slight discharge of
smoke and a noise, resulting from activation
of the pyrotechnic charge incorporated in the
system.
Although this smoke is not harmful, sensitive
individuals may experience slight irritation.
The noise of the detonation may result in a
slight loss of hearing for a short time.
Front airbags
System that protects the driver and front
passenger(s) in the event of a serious front
impact, in order to limit the risk of head and
chest injury.
The driver's airbag is fitted in the centre of the
steering wheel; the front passenger(s) airbag is
fitted in the dashboard above the glove box.
